I made a resource bar addon that works for every class and spec, auto detects your resources, and saves settings per spec.

Hey everyone,

I wanted to share a new addon I just released called ResourceArchitect.

It is a resource bar replacement that works for every class and spec out of the box. It auto detects your primary resource (energy, rage, fury, insanity, maelstrom, etc.) and your secondary resource (combo points, holy power, runes, soul shards, chi, arcane charges, stagger, soul fragments, maelstrom weapon stacks, and more), then renders both in one clean frame.

Here is the quick breakdown:

Smart Display Mode:
An auto mode figures out which resource actually matters for your spec. Ret Paladin? Shows holy power, hides mana. Warlock? Shows soul shards. Rogue? Shows both energy and combo points. You can also force it to always show both or only the secondary.

Per Spec Profiles:
Settings are saved per character and per spec automatically. Swap specs and the bar reconfigures itself. Log onto an alt and it loads that character's setup. No manual profile switching needed.

Secondary Resource Support:
Combo points with charged CP coloring, holy power, chi, soul shards, arcane charges, DK runes with per spec colors and recharge visualization, brewmaster stagger as a proportional bar, and aura tracked stacks like maelstrom weapon, icicles, tip of the spear, and whirlwind. It also tracks Devourer soul fragments both in and out of Void Meta, including Soul Glutton cap changes.

Layout Options:
Secondary indicators can span the full bar width or use fixed size blocks. Position them above, below, or at a custom anchor. Set direction, spacing, and use advanced grouping to visually split blocks (e.g. 3+3 runes).

Full Customization:
Textures, colors, sizing, smooth animation, spark, border, resource text with font and outline controls, threshold markers at ability cost breakpoints with spec aware defaults, and visibility modes (always, combat, target, hide while mounted, fade in/out).

Live Preview:
The settings panel has a live preview with spec aware animations so you can see exactly what your bar will look like before you lock it in.

It also handles Druid form tracking, so the bar switches between energy, rage, lunar power, and mana live as you shift.

EmpireManager - rules-based item routing across all your alts

EmpireManager - one addon to manage every alt, every bag, every bank.

It's a rules-based inventory router for alt-heavy accounts: you write rules once ("all ore goes to BankAlt", "all herbs to my Alchemist"), and it sorts and mails items into the right place automatically.

What it does

  • Match items by name, type, tags, or custom conditions, with ordered priority.
  • Route to: bank, a specific alt's stash, mail (with fallback recipients), vendor, or local stash.
  • Assign roles to characters (crafter, banker, gatherer) and use them as routing targets so rules survive when you swap which alt is your banker.
  • Preview every batch before anything moves. Nothing is automatic without your click.
  • Handles the annoying edges: non-mailable items, mail size limits, vendor-only stuff, soulbound gear - it stashes instead of failing.
  • Only runs when you open a bag/bank/mail/vendor.

I made an addon that integrates artisan discovery directly into WoW’s crafting UI

I’ve been working on a WoW addon called ArtisanFinder and I’d love some feedback from fellow goblins/profession enjoyers.

The goal is to make it easier to find and advertise artisans in-game without relying entirely on trade chat spam, while staying fully integrated with Blizzard’s profession UI.

For customers, ArtisanFinder adds artisan search directly into the crafting order window, allowing players to quickly find available crafters from the crafting interface itself.

Customer View: Customer View image

For artisans, the addon integrates into the profession window and lets them advertise their services, prices, craft quality, notes, and availability without constantly reposting in trade chat.

Artisan View: Artisan View image

One thing I specifically wanted to avoid was requiring manual profile setup. The addon automatically scans profession data directly from the game, including craft quality information, so customers can immediately see what quality an artisan can produce without the artisan having to manually configure everything.

Artisans can also share additional information such as pricing/tips, notes/services, and availability.

The addon also includes an availability system:

  • manually opt in/out whenever you want
  • optional automatic mode
  • automatically marks you available in capitals
  • automatically disables availability when entering instances/raids

Options: Options Panel image

The addon communicates between players who also have ArtisanFinder installed, so the more people use it, the more useful it becomes.
